RBI Monetary Policy: Repo Rate Unchanged, FY26 Inflation at 2.1%

Context
• RBI’s Monetary Policy Committee (MPC) kept the repo rate unchanged at 5.25%.
• Stance remains neutral.
• Inflation projection for FY26: 2.1%.
• Growth outlook positive, but risks from geopolitical tensions and precious metal prices persist.

Monetary Policy Committee (MPC)
• Legal basis: RBI Act, 1934 (amended in 2016)
• Objective: Achieve inflation targeting while supporting growth
• Inflation target: 4% ± 2% (set for 5 years)

Composition (6 members)
• RBI: Governor (Chair), Deputy Governor (Monetary Policy), one RBI nominee
• Government: 3 independent experts

Decision-making
• One vote per member
• Majority decision
• Governor has casting vote in case of tie
• Minimum 4 meetings per year
